Default Mercury Racing QCV4 - difference in length between 700 and 1350?

Single engine boat. The 700Sci / NXT package has been happily installed for some time.

I've got 4-3/4" remaining between outer nut of the tensioner and the bulkhead forward.

I've got 6" remaining between outer surface of supercharger pulley and the bulkhead forward.

I was told previously the 1100/1350 package would not fit.

Could some folks please chime in and tell me
1) If you think 1350 package would fit as is - I know I could
always chop and cut
2) If you have any specific measurements that indicate just how many inches longer overall the 1350 package is over the 700 Sci package.
